r318: *** empty log message ***
[ctsim.git] / include / imagefile.h
index a7e69d75f54dba97efacc239d0de3ec7b57cfbb7..7c7daba56eae43d69172b47763cbb2dd69fa7a28 100644 (file)
@@ -9,7 +9,7 @@
 **  This is part of the CTSim program
 **  Copyright (C) 1983-2000 Kevin Rosenberg
 **
-**  $Id: imagefile.h,v 1.23 2000/12/22 04:18:00 kevin Exp $
+**  $Id: imagefile.h,v 1.24 2000/12/29 15:45:06 kevin Exp $
 **
 **  This program is free software; you can redistribute it and/or modify
 **  it under the terms of the GNU General Public License (version 2) as
@@ -120,25 +120,25 @@ class ImageFile : public ImageFileBase
   void filterResponse (const char* const domainName, double bw, const char* const filterName, double filt_param);
 
   void statistics (double& min, double& max, double& mean, double& mode, double& median, double& stddev) const;
-
   void getMinMax (double& min, double& max) const;
-
   void printStatistics (std::ostream& os) const;
-
   bool comparativeStatistics (const ImageFile& imComp, double& d, double& r, double& e) const;
-
   bool printComparativeStatistics (const ImageFile& imComp, std::ostream& os) const;
 \r
-  bool subtractImages (const ImageFile& rRHS, ImageFile& result) const;\r
-
+  bool subtractImages (const ImageFile& rRHS, ImageFile& result) const;
   bool addImages (const ImageFile& rRHS, ImageFile& result) const;\r
-\r
   bool multiplyImages (const ImageFile& rRHS, ImageFile& result) const;\r
-\r
   bool divideImages (const ImageFile& rRHS, ImageFile& result) const;\r
 \r
+  bool invertPixelValues (ImageFile& result) const;\r
+  bool sqrt (ImageFile& result) const;\r
+  bool square (ImageFile& result) const;\r
+  bool log (ImageFile& result) const;\r
+  bool exp (ImageFile& result) const;\r
+  bool FFTMagnitude (ImageFile& result) const;\r
+  bool FFTPhase (ImageFile& result) const;\r
+\r
   int display (void) const;
-
   int displayScaling (const int scaleFactor, ImageFileValue pmin, ImageFileValue pmax) const;
 
 #if HAVE_PNG